# CrashFunnel Data Stores

CrashFunnel ingests crash reports from the Pebbleton mobile apps and writes raw payloads to object storage under `crash-raw/`. Symbolicated stack traces and dedup fingerprints live in Postgres; the `reports` table is append-only, and reviewers should flag any migration that adds updates to it. Retention is 90 days for raw payloads, 1 year for fingerprints. The symbolication workers connect to the primary database with this connection string.

primary connection of tafog-tawig = clickhouse://novael_svc:x4ud78w@db-4f8d.urlaqworks.local:5432/aldael

Ticket: Vendored fonts in the Quillbarn UI repo are out of date and two weights are missing licenses in-tree. Replace the stale files with the approved Glyphden set, update the attribution manifest, and re-run the asset pipeline. When you open the PR, paste the pipeline's trace token, which appears below.

pipeline stamp: htk9_ce63042d9

TURN-208: Gatevale turnstile counters at the Merrow Field pilot double-count when a rotation reverses mid-cycle. Attendance totals drift roughly 2% high per event. The debounce window fix is implemented, reviewed by Ilsa, and soak-tested across two simulated match days without drift. Ready for your cut; the candidate build is identified below.

trace token, tagag-tafog: htk6_5ed18c